WATT  is seeking a Construction Supervisor to join our team in our Calgary office. The Construction Supervisor will supervise, inspect, and coordinate construction activities, both as a Prime Consultant and as a Sub-Consultant on various Land Development projects. In addition, work closely with project managers, project engineers, and designers to prepare tender/contract document packages and opinions of probable costs at various stages of design development.  Our Construction Supervisor will have an opportunity to train/mentor junior field technical staff.

QUALIFICATIONS

  • E.T. or eligibility to become a C.E.T., with a minimum of 5 years’ experience in construction supervision of land development and municipal projects in Calgary and surrounding areas.
  • Proficient in the use of Microsoft Office Suite programs.
  • Excellent oral, written, and interpersonal communication skills.
  • Familiarity with Municipality specifications and CCC/FAC process.
  • CAD experience would be helpful but not mandatory.
  • CPESC certification would be an asset.
  • Pipeline Assessment Certification Program (PACP), Manhole Assessment Certification Program (MACP), Lateral Assessment Certification Program (LACP) -National Association of Sewer Service Companies (NASSCO) will be assets.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Supervise day-to-day construction activities, including Erosion and Sedimentation Control inspections, either in person or via junior technicians in field, including survey and quality control testing coordination.  Record and prepare daily progress reports and Local Municipality inspection forms.
  • Train/mentor junior field staff.
  • Perform and manage all tasks associated with the administration of construction contracts including tender and specification preparation, cost estimation, tender letting, review, analysis, and award recommendations.
  • Maintain project files and all relevant QC documentation for construction projects.
  • Receive Contractor draft invoices, review and advise Contractor of revisions, prepare Project Progress Claims (PPC) for signoff by PM and issue PPC’s to client for payment.  Maintain PPC tracking system for all PPC’s.
  • Assist in the creation and preparation of proposals for both public and private sector clients including projected field staff utilization and broad scope project costs.
  • Act as a resource to PM’s and designers in the gathering of information and/or pricing for non-typical items.
  • Liaise and keep the client informed on changes and challenges encountered during construction phase of project.  Discuss additional costs incurred in the field due to site conditions.
  • Attend CCC & FAC inspections with Local Authority, record deficiencies, inspect completed deficiencies, and prepare CCC & FAC certificates, and all supporting documentation for submission to Local Authority for acceptance.
  • Ensure that work on sites being carried out safely and in compliance with OH&S requirements.
